School Highlights
Ohio Business College-Hilliard served 178 students (84% of students were full-time).
The college's student:teacher ratio of 20:1 was higher than the state community college average of 17:1.
Minority enrollment was 28% of the student body (majority Black), which was equal to the state average of 28%.
